About Kyoto

Kyoto, Japan, is a city rich in history and culture, making it a fascinating destination. One of the best things to do is to explore the historic temples scattered throughout the city. Notable sites include Kinkaku-ji, the Golden Pavilion, which is renowned for its stunning architecture and serene gardens, and Kiyomizu-dera, famous for its wooden stage that offers impressive views of the surrounding area, especially during cherry blossom season.

Another essential experience is wandering through the traditional neighborhoods, such as Gion. This area is known for its wooden machiya houses and is a great place to catch a glimpse of geisha culture. Walking along the cobblestone streets, particularly in the evening, provides a sense of stepping back in time.

Kyoto is also famous for its zen gardens. Ryoan-ji, with its minimalist rock garden, invites contemplation and reflection. Visiting these gardens can provide a peaceful respite from the busier tourist areas.

Culinary experiences in Kyoto are noteworthy, especially sampling kaiseki cuisine. This traditional multi-course meal emphasizes seasonal ingredients and exquisite presentation. Visitors can find restaurants offering kaiseki that provide an insight into the local culinary culture.

For a more interactive experience, participating in a tea ceremony is highly recommended. This ritualistic preparation of matcha tea offers a unique perspective on Japanese culture and hospitality. There are several venues across Kyoto where one can learn about this art form.

Lastly, don't miss the chance to explore the bamboo groves of Arashiyama. Walking through the towering bamboo stalks creates a serene atmosphere, and nearby attractions like the Iwatayama Monkey Park add an element of adventure.

In summary, Kyoto offers a blend of historical exploration, cultural experiences, and natural beauty, making it a worthwhile destination for any traveler.
